Cynical Software Jun 2026

Just like the ones in your home, these "trip" when a service starts failing. Instead of repeatedly hammering a broken API (and potentially bringing down your own app), the circuit breaker stops the calls immediately, giving the external service time to recover.

"cynical software" typically refers to one of two things: a specific cynical approach to software engineering (often found in academic prompts like "why do organizations refer to milestones as millstones?") or the modern trend of software built with "dark patterns" and user exploitation in mind. cynical software

Cynical Software is the digital equivalent of a landlord who fixes the leaky pipe just enough to stop the ceiling from caving in, but leaves the water damage because cleaning it up doesn't generate rent. Just like the ones in your home, these

Cynical software is not just inflicted on users; it is inflicted on the developers who build it. In a cynical engineering culture, every decision is defensive. Cynical Software is the digital equivalent of a

Helpful features in this domain focus on protecting the system from its own users, its environment, and even its own code.

Cynical software leverages dopamine loops to keep users engaged. Features like "streaks," infinite scrolls, and variable reward notifications are borrowed directly from the psychology of slot machines. The goal isn't to provide value; it’s to trigger a compulsion. 3. Planned Friction

Back
Top